AB 327
Requires the Legislative Auditor to conduct an audit of certain financial information and employment matters relating to public broadcasting. (BDR S-860)

Bill overview
This bill directs the Nevada Legislative Auditor to conduct audits of Vegas PBS and the Department of Education’s grant programs for public broadcasting organizations. Specifically, the audit of Vegas PBS will examine its financial management, employment practices, budget, and hiring processes. The audit of the Department of Education’s grants will analyze their distribution and historical increases to each receiving organization. The findings of these audits will be presented to the Audit Subcommittee of the Legislative Commission.
